初中生学习编程需要的基础主要包括:1、逻辑思维能力;2、基本的数学知识;3、英语阅读能力。 在这三者中,逻辑思维能力尤为关键。它是解决编程问题的基石,帮助学生理解编程语言的结构和规则,更有效地学习和应用编程知识。逻辑思维能力的培养不仅在编程学习中起到至关重要的作用,也对学生的整体认知发展和其他学科学习有着广泛的积极影响。
一、逻辑思维能力的培养
逻辑思维是编程教育的核心。它涉及到问题的有效分析、解决方案的设计以及优化过程。初中生可以通过玩逻辑游戏、学习算法和参与编程项目来逐渐培养这一能力。更具体的,编程课程中的问题解决和项目设计环节,可以让学生们在实践中锻炼思考和应用的能力。
二、基本数学知识的重要性
编程中涉及许多数学概念,如变量、算法、逻辑运算等。拥有扎实的数学基础能让学生在学习编程时更加游刃有余。特别是代数、几何和统计学等数学领域的知识,它们在编程中的应用尤为广泛。通过数学学习,学生不仅可以提高对编程问题的理解能力,还能锻炼抽象思维,为更高级的编程学习打下坚实的基础。
三、英语阅读能力的必要性
英语是国际通用的编程语言。大多数编程语言的关键字、文档及社区交流都是以英语为主。因此,具备一定的英语阅读能力对初中生学习编程尤为重要。这不仅有助于他们更好地理解编程语言和概念,还可以让他们通过阅读官方文档和参与国际社区的讨论来提升自己的编程技能。
四、持续学习与实践的重要性
在快速发展的技术领域,持续学习是必不可少的。初中生在掌握基础知识的同时,也应该养成自主学习的习惯,通过在线教育平台、技术论坛和社区进行持续的学习和交流。实践是检验真知的唯一标准。通过编写真实的程序项目,学生不仅可以将所学知识应用到实践中,还能在解决问题的过程中提升自己的编程能力和创新思维。
总的来说,初中生学习编程是一个系统工程,需要多方位的知识与技能支撑。在掌握逻辑思维能力、基本数学知识和英语阅读能力的基础上,持续的学习和实践活动将进一步提升学生们的编程技能,为他们的未来职业发展奠定坚实的基础。
相关问答FAQs:
初中生学编程需要什么文化?
- 什么是编程文化?
编程文化是指编程领域内的专业知识、技能和态度等方面的涵养和培养。它包括对计算机科学和编程的基本概念的理解,对算法和数据结构的掌握,以及对编程语言和工具的熟悉。此外,编程文化还包括解决问题和创造力的培养,以及对协作和沟通的重视。
初中生学编程需要什么样的文化?
- 培养计算思维能力:计算思维是一种通过问题分析和解决的方式来理解和应用计算机科学的能力。初中生在学习编程之前需要培养解决问题的能力,这可以通过逻辑思考和数学学习来提升。
- 培养创造力:编程是一种创造性的活动,学习编程需要培养创造力和创新精神。初中生可以通过参加编程比赛、阅读相关的书籍和文章以及参与实际的编码项目来培养创造力。
- 学会合作与沟通:编程往往需要与他人合作完成项目,初中生需要学会与其他人合作以及良好的沟通技巧。他们可以参加编程社区或者加入编程俱乐部,与同龄人一起学习、讨论和分享编程经验。
初中生学编程如何培养相关文化?
- 可以参加编程社区或者加入编程俱乐部,与其他初中生一起学习和分享编程经验。
- 可以参加各类编程比赛,提升编程能力和创造力,并与他人合作解决问题。
- 阅读与编程相关的书籍、文章和教程,了解计算机科学和编程的基本概念和原理。
- 参与开源项目或者自己动手实践,通过实际的编码项目来提升技能和培养解决问题的能力。
- 学会与他人合作和沟通,可以通过参加团队项目或者组织编程活动来培养这方面的能力。
总之,初中生学习编程需要培养计算思维能力、创造力以及合作与沟通的能力。通过参加编程社区、比赛和实践项目,以及阅读相关书籍和文章等方式,初中生可以培养出与编程相关的文化。同时,也要注重解决问题的能力和创造性思维的培养,这些都是初中生学习编程所需要的基本要素。
文章标题:初中生学编程需要什么文化,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1687734